Compote of Fruit in Sauternes - pareve

2 1/2 cups Sauternes or other sweet white wine
Zest of 1 lemon, cut in julienne strips
6 prunes
4 fresh or dried figs
2 large green apples, cored and cut into eighths
2 tablespoons sugar
1 cinnamon stick
1/2 cup walnut halves
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
In a medium mixing bowl, combine wine, lemon zest, prunes and dried figs
(if used). Maarinate at room temperature 6 hours, or refrigerate for
longer.
Transfer mixture to a medium saucepan and add apples, sugar, cinnamon
stick and walnut halves. Cook for 5 minutes at medium-low temperature.
If using fresh figs, halve or quarter them (depending on size) and add
to saucepan. Simmer another 5 minutes.
Remove from heat and cool slightly; stir in vanilla, then cool to room
temperature.
Serve at room temperature or chill slightly. Remove cinnamon stick
before serving.
Serves 6.
